RE: [Fedora-directory-users] support for non-localy stored passwords?



Quoting Pete Rowley <pete openrowley com>:

It occurs to me that a simple pre-operation bind plugin plus pam would
probably solve your problem.  The plugin would alter the bind credentials so
that the realm is added appropriateley - then it is simply a matter of
setting up kerberos correctly for multiple domains and using the kerberos
pam plugin.

For that matter a simple pam auth plugin could do this too, though slightly
less efficiently since it would need to query the DS to get the realm.

Of course, this all requires code :)

Hmmm... Somehow I have a feeling that it would take less coding to add support
for '{SASL}' stuff in FDS password verification code ;-)


(haven't seen the actual code, so just a wild guess)
